JQuery是一款广泛应用于web开发中的JavaScript库,它简化了JavaScript在网页中的应用,使得开发者可以更方便地控制DOM元素、响应交互事件以及创建动态效果。
其中,JQuery的对话框组件(Dialog)是一种非常实用的工具。通过Dialog,开发者可以自定义弹出框,并且可以在弹出框中加入自己的HTML代码和CSS样式。JQuery 1.10是一个非常稳定的版本,它在Dialog组件方面也有一些优化。
$('#dialog').dialog({ autoOpen: false, // 默认不自动弹出 draggable: false, // 禁止拖动 resizable: false, // 禁止调整大小 modal: true, // 模态框,遮罩其他元素 show: 'blind', // 打开时的动画效果 hide: 'fold', // 关闭时的动画效果 dialogClass: 'custom-dialog', // 自定义对话框样式 width: 400, // 窗口宽度 height: 300 // 窗口高度 });
上面的代码创建了一个ID为“dialog”的对话框,其中autoOpen、draggable、resizable和modal属性均为Dialog提供的基本功能。show和hide属性则提供了一些动画效果。
Dialog还可以通过dialogClass属性来添加自定义样式。例如,上面的代码中使用了名为“custom-dialog”的样式类。在CSS文件中定义该类样式,即可实现个性化的对话框风格。
JQuery 1.10 Dialog的强大功能使得开发者可以创建高度定制化的弹出框,并且可以附加自己的HTML代码和CSS。开发者可以根据自己的需求,选择开启或关闭Dialog的基础功能,实现对话框的个性化定制。